Can Mycelium Fungus replace Concrete & Plastic?

One promising solution to plastic pollution is mycelium or mushroom packaging. It is made of 2 ingredients: mushrooms and hemp. Mycelium is the underground network of very durable, thread-like filaments called hyphae. It is mixed with agricultural waste like wood chips, oat hulls, cotton burrs or hemp hurds.

One of the largest mushroom packaging manufacturers in the world is Ecovative Design, a New York based biotech company founded in 2006. They sent me these samples of their product. Their manufacturing process is pretty straight forward.

Their designers create a 3D CAD model of custom packaging
A CNC machine routes the design into MDF.
Plastic trays are thermoformed around the MDF pieces.
The tray is filled with their proprietary hemp hurd and mycelium blend.
It is allowed to grow for 4 days in a controlled environment with regulated temperatures, airflow, CO2 and humidity levels.
It is popped out of tray and allowed to continue growing for 2 more days to create a velvety layer of overgrowth
The packaging is then heat treated to dry out, kill spores and stop the growth process

This material can last for 30 years in dry, temperature controlled indoor environments. It is also 100% biodegradable and a nutrient for soils and plants. When broken down into 1 cubic centimeter pieces, it will compost in just 45 days. In the ocean, it will compost in 180 days.

In 2014, a 40 ft or 12 meter high tower was built in New York by The Living, an architectural design studio, Ecovative and Arup. 10,000 bricks made of mycelium and corn stalks were stacked to form 3 interwoven chimneys.

In 2019, a drum-shaped temporary pavilion was designed in the Netherlands. It was composed of a timber frame, actively growing mushroom wall panels and seating made of agricultural waste.

Biohm, a UK based startup, has developed a mycelium insulation panel that outperforms traditional insulation like rockwool and fiberglass in terms of thermal capacity, fire resistance and acoustic performance.

ADVANTAGES
Mushroom packaging and other mycelium based products are non-toxic and free of VOCs and formaldehydes. This product consumes a tenth of the energy of foam, and emits an eighth of the amount of greenhouse gases. It is Cradle to Cradle Gold certified. It is an excellent example of a sustainable, circular economy product. It is quite spongy so it can protect fragile materials just as well as petroleum-based foam. Ecovative claims that it is a cost, time and performance competitive solution to plastic packaging.

Mushroom Packaging is naturally hydrophobic or water resistant. Water droplets roll right off and do not soak through. This makes it an ideal material for packing cold items and ice packs that can melt. However, prolonged exposure to moisture and high humidity will lead to mold. Due to the inherent properties of mycelium, this material is a class A fire retardant and has a very low flame spread of 20.

DISADVANTAGES
It is not very strong. It has a compressive strength of just 18 psi so it cannot be used as a structural material. It also has a short lifespan of 20 to 30 years. It can’t be used as food storage containers, so it won’t replace styrofoam right now. Since it is such a new technology, the few companies that produce these have patented the production process which is a barrier to entry. The super low cost of plastic production is unfortunately a huge deterrent to the future of this technology. Plastic also offers a lot of advantages like long term water resistance and a long lifespan.

The plastic industry has been complacent for too long and has avoided setting up an extensive recycling network. I hope competition will force them to be more responsible.
